Early Roots: Where Art and Identity First Connected

Eric Haze’s story starts in the streets of New York, during a time when graffiti wasn’t “art” in the mainstream sense — it was expression, rebellion, community, and a bold announcement of identity. He wasn’t just tagging walls; he was shaping a visual language. That early passion, that need to create, formed the backbone of everything that would later shape Eric Haze net worth. What made Haze different was his ability to see beyond the moment. While many young artists were focused only on the movement, he recognized the future potential of urban art. He embraced style, precision, and consistency — the traits that would eventually make his lettering, his logos, and his designs iconic.

From Graffiti to Graphic Designer: Expanding Talent Into Opportunity

As hip-hop culture exploded across New York, Haze realized that the same energy he poured into walls could be brought to album covers, logos, and branding. This is where the early seeds of Eric Haze net worth truly began to sprout. He started working as a graphic designer, and his style quickly became sought after. His hand-drawn typography and bold line work helped shape the visual identity of early hip-hop, street culture, and emerging artists. Estimating Eric Haze Net Worth: What the Numbers Suggest

While Eric Haze is a private person and doesn’t publicly reveal financial documents, most industry estimates place Eric Haze net worth in the $5 million to $10 million range. This figure reflects decades of work, including revenue from apparel, brand collaborations, art sales, licensing deals, design royalties, exhibitions, and ongoing creative projects.
